Description

The Primary Care & Specialty Service Nursing Supervisor coordinates and directs the overall functions of the Internal Medicine and Infectious Disease nursing departments, including the rooming, triage, and practice nurses at both the Plaza & River Campus locations. The supervisor works with administration, site coordinators, providers, other department supervisors/staff, team leads, providers, nursing staff, and community resources to render professional patient care. The supervisor also serves as a clinical expert and resource.

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's degree in nursing required
  • Registered Nurse (RN) in the State of MN
  • Current American Heart Association (AHA) BLS Healthcare Provider card required per established policy
  • 2 years of staff supervisory experience preferred
  • 2 years of leadership/management experience with a health care team preferred
  • 2 years of Epic EMR in an ambulatory care setting preferred
  • Ability to lead, mentor, and motivate employees to be productive and efficient
  • Self motivated and able to work independently as well as in a team setting with minimal supervision
  • Is detail oriented and provides timely follow through with minor and major assignments
  • Ability to manage resources and staff within budget requirements
